MGM is the worst hotel in in my experience when it comes to asking for upgrades even with a tip.
I have stayed there 3 times, never been upgraded and twice they havent even had the room I requested (non smoking 2 queens). Once got a king room non smoking and the other time a 2 queen smoking. Had a decent view 2 out of the 3 times though.
Once went with a group and we needed three rooms and we ended up 2 on one floor and the other on a different floor.
They only have 5500 rooms after all!!
The standard grand tower rooms are ok, but best to ask for high floor with strip view if that is what you want and hope for the best
In summary dont hold out to much hope of getting an upgrade or having 5 rooms close together0 -
